What a dehumidifier does for Derriaghy homes

The idea is simple: the unit draws in damp air, the moisture condenses and collects in a tank (or drains away), and drier air is pushed back into the room. For a cellar or cold room in Derriaghy, you'll want a model suited to cool spaces and matched to the volume you're drying.

How much does it cost in Derriaghy?

Hiring beats buying when the need is short-term (after a wet winter, a leak, or before a sale). In Derriaghy, expect around £10 to £25 a day depending on the model, with discounts over a week or more.

What size dehumidifier do I need in Derriaghy?

For a cold or unheated room, choose a compressor model rated for low temperatures and matched to the room size. Skip the little moisture absorbers — they're too small for a genuinely damp room in Derriaghy.

Are dehumidifiers expensive to run?

Running costs stay reasonable: a domestic unit often runs a few hours a day thanks to the built-in humidistat, which switches it off once the target humidity is reached.

Does this stop mould coming back in Derriaghy?

Yes, indirectly — mould thrives on damp air. Hold the humidity down and you break the cycle. For heavy growth, treat the surface first, then dry the room.
